What is custom software?

Organizations have several options to acquire software, including off-the-shelf or commercial, SaaS and custom. Off-the-shelf and SaaS options make it simple and fast to install and implement technology that delivers business results. 

While convenient, ready-made solutions that are built to meet the needs of a majority of users often don’t meet the unique needs of an individual business. For example, companies may need clearer differentiation from competitors. They may need software that works in their unique, complex environment. They may need software that integrates seamlessly with other apps. 

For these companies, building custom software, sometimes also called bespoke software, makes good business sense. Just like custom-made clothing that is designed to a specific individual’s measurements, style and materials preferences, and budget constraints, custom software is designed and built to meet a specific organization’s unique requirements. With custom software development, organizations achieve more targeted solutions, greater scalability, and increased reliability, in a much more cost-effective way than alternative software solutions.

What are the types of custom software development?

Custom software development is as varied and versatile as the needs of a business. You can custom-develop just about any application for any industry. Here are just a few examples of custom software development.

Custom enterprise web applications 

Whether leveraging an on-premises or hybrid multi-cloud environment, custom enterprise web applications help an organization manage business operations, whether internally or externally. By leveraging responsive and extensible web technologies to deliver business functionality, companies can significantly reduce costs and the time required to develop and deploy the solution. They can also make the solution more accessible to more users, wherever they may be.

Examples include an online shopping and payment processing application, an enterprise content management system, a customer relationship management (CRM) system, an internal project management system, or a supply chain application.

Custom mobile applications

Mobile has become the primary way people access the internet, with mobile devices accounting for nearly 60% of global website traffic. The expansion of the 5g network globally will fuel mobile app growth, too, with faster speeds and lower latency improving the responsiveness of smartphone and tablet applications. Whether for iOS, Android, or something else like wearables, mobile apps are versatile, enabling companies to integrate their enterprise applications with the customers, employees, and partners they do business with every day. Custom mobile apps can enable e-commerce and remote work options so people are able to conveniently transact from anywhere they have cellular service or Internet access. They can deliver new ways for people to interact with and control IoT devices. They can be used for on-demand training. The possibilities are endless. 

Custom e-commerce applications

With e-commerce reaching nearly 25% market share by 2025, many companies see significant opportunities in expanding their online sales. A custom e-commerce application can be crucial when you want or need complete control and flexibility in how you design and implement an end-to-end customer experience that creates delighted customers and passionate brand advocates who keep coming back for more. A custom e-commerce application also gives you more control over integration with your enterprise applications in a way that works best for your business, including optimizing how backend users work with the system. 

Custom data-driven applications

Many companies today are struggling to harness the untapped power of all the data that is coming from the surge in cloud solutions, mobile applications, and IoT devices. Custom data-driven applications can provide a way for you to collect, extract, transform, and load your data into a consolidated data lake in the cloud or on-prem so that you can use predictive analytics and machine learning to obtain actionable insights that improve business outcomes. 

Custom IoT applications

We live in a world full of smart devices, clothing and accessories, smart homes, smart cars, and smart cities. As with mobile apps, the growth of 5g is expected to spur IoT app development. In an Internet of Things (IoT) world powered by billions of interconnected sensors that can be used to collect data on and control lighting, heat regulation, fuel efficiency optimization, medical treatment, and just about anything you can imagine. Whether you need to track data and control devices in a manufacturing environment or combine IoT with big data, artificial intelligence (AI), and machine learning (ML) capabilities to create a smart, connected enterprise, custom IoT applications can help you build new business models, generate more revenue, and deliver more engaging tailored customer experiences.

Innovate faster: Access the best tech talent with a custom software services provider

With technology advancing rapidly and the increasingly urgent push for digitalization across so many aspects of business, your in-house development team may struggle to keep pace. Gartner® estimates, “one in three skills in an average 2017 job posting in IT, finance or sales are already obsolete.”[1] The ongoing shortage of developers further complicates matters. Tech jobs consistently rank at the top of the list of the biggest challenges for recruiters, and the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ics estimates that the shortage of engineers will exceed 1.2 million by 2026. 

The downstream impacts of the tech skills and tech talent shortages are enormous. The U.S. could miss out on over $160 billion of annual revenues by 2030 if more developers aren’t added to the market (Korn Ferry). The resulting job market squeeze pushes developer salaries higher, making them among the most highly compensated jobs in IT. When companies can’t get the skills they need, the burden often shifts to current employees, which, in turn, contributes to lower morale, lower productivity, and costly turnover.

Optimize for continuous value delivery: Partner with a proven custom software services provider 

When you are building business-critical software products, you need to ensure frequent and consistent delivery of value to the business, from the initial hypothesis to building, releasing, and improving the product over time. In the Scaled Agile Framework (SAFe®), this is called the continuous delivery pipeline. With a high-functioning continuous delivery pipeline, you can experiment with new ideas faster, reduce the mean time to resolve (MTTR) issues in production, reduce downtime for customers, and more. But building and maintaining a continuous delivery pipeline that delivers high-quality products predictably, reliably, and on a timeline that meets business demands is complex. A custom software services provider can provide the skills, experience, and coaching you need to recommend the tools most appropriate for your team and product, map your existing workflows to the pipeline, identify opportunities for improvements, and monitor delivery through your pipeline so that you can keep the business updated about the value you’re delivering.
